When you use vending machines, are you hitting back on your browser (or delete, or if you have it set to a mouse button, whatever)? You should always use the "Back" link on the page with the item you got. And if you ever get that message, the easiest fix is to click on the address in the address bar and hit enter, on the page with the vending machine itself.

Vending machines can get "stuck" really easily--if you accidentally click the machine twice before it loads the item page, if you go back to the previous page any way other than clicking the "Back" link, if you hit refresh, if you just managed to be unlucky that day, I dunno. Heh. It's a bit annoying. What I usually do is position my mouse exactly where the "Back" link is and click, wait, click, wait, click, wait, without ever moving my mouse.
